
Mold can be defined as small living organisms that are classified under the fungi family. Mold spores have been known to thrive in moist surfaces, and their growth can spread very quickly more especially in humid areas. Mold can grow on any surface, but it does so mostly on those that are made from cellulose.
Recent research has established that the majority of people in homes are suffering from infections that are brought about by the presence of unwanted moisture in their houses. When there is excessive moisture in the house, there is the rapid growth of mold in those areas of the house that are damp like basements that are water damaged, roof, bathroom or even areas like leaking pipes.

Hunt for It
The first step towards detecting toxic mold is hunting for it physically. When you know the natural characteristics of it, then it is straightforward for you to discover it visibly. When you see something looking like a cotton-like element, then understand that that is it. Some of the other colors that it can appear in include green, black, grey or white.
Smell the Mold
One of the most common ways that one can test for toxic mold even though it is not recommended for obvious reasons is by smelling it. If you feel it and you realize that it has an odor that is strong and earthy, then definitely know that this must be toxic mold. So if you realize that there are moldy smells that within your house, then you should plan to eliminate them immediately. Even though not all of them smell, be wary of those that do not emit any odor and they are likely to be found between canals and panels.
Use the DIY Mold Testing Kit
Another way that you can test for toxic mold is by getting yourself a do-it-yourself testing kit. This is the most recommended way of testing for toxic mold. You can usually get this kit from the home improvement stores, supermarket or hardware that deals with such an item. These kits are generally easy to use as you only need to follow the instruction given and you are sure of obtaining immediate results.
Use the Services of a Certified Inspector
There are instances where you can be experiencing symptoms of mold exposure, but you cannot detect or determine their presence within the house. In the event of such like situation, it is advisable that you seek the services of a certified mold inspector.
